FP16 EOO is a 2016 Vauxhall Vivaro in White with a 1,598c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.

Across all 2016 Vauxhall Vivaro models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.3% with a typical mileage of 72,558 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Vauxhall Vivaro f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 144,341 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FP16 EOO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Vauxhall Vivaro typ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 10 years old, this Vauxhall Vivaro is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
